In Dubai, flights to Trondheim usually depart from Dubai International Airport (DXB). This is one of the largest and most modern airports in the world, offering a wide range of services for passengers. In Trondheim, flights arrive at Trondheim Airport Værnes (TRD). This is a small but convenient airport, located approximately 20 kilometers from the city center.
From Dubai Airport (DXB): You can get to the city by taxi, bus, or metro. The metro is the fastest and cheapest way to get to the city center. From Trondheim Airport Værnes (TRD): You can get to the city by bus or taxi. The bus is the most affordable option, but a taxi is the most convenient.

Most flights involve one transfer, usually in European cities such as Amsterdam, Frankfurt, or London.
A direct flight is the best choice if time is important. A flight with a transfer may be cheaper but will take more time.
The total flight time, including transfer, is usually from 8 to 12 hours.
